  • Page 2 Connect audio cable from the SPDIF jack on the rear of the TV to the DIGITAL IN jack on the rear of the hi-fi system. Note : SPDIF (Sony and Philips Digital Interconnect Format) is highly recommended for high quality digital sound output.
